The Emblem of Manipur is the state emblem of Manipur, India. It was officially adopted by the state government on 18 December 1980.[1]
Design
The emblem features a Kanglasha, a mythological creature that is half-lion and half-dragon.[2]

Government banner
The Government of Manipur can be represented by a banner displaying the emblem of the state on a white field.[3][4]
